1989, Yugoslavia. Proof Silver 50,000 Dinara "Non-Aligned Summit" Coin. Top Pop! PCGS PR69 DC!

Mint Year: 1989
Reference: KM-136.
Mintage: 15,000 pcs. 
Denomination: 50,000 Dinara Non-aligned Summit.
Condition: Certified and graded by PCGS as PR-69 DC! - Top Pop 1/0!

Material: Silver (.925)
Diameter: 30mm
Weight: 13gm

The Socialist Republic of Serbia (Serbo-Croatian: Социјалистичка Република Србија / Socijalistička Republika Srbija) was one of the six constitute republics of the Socialist Federal Republic of Yugoslavia. It was the largest republic in terms of population and territory. Its capital, Belgrade, was also the federal capital of Yugoslavia
